Default What wing setting for NCM? APR GTC300 on C5z

I bought this car with the wing on it, already. What hole should the front be set at? I have it all the way up, per my buddy Jerry Onks. But it looks like it'll create more lift than df. I'll be at NCM several times this summer, if it matters.

If you place a level parallel with the end plates you will be able to set at zero. Due to the design of this wing, I believe that still delivers a twelve degree angle of attack ( observe the outer portions of the wing or place a protractor on them.

I have also used a piece of square aluminum stock and set it down the middle of the wing, then used an angle finger to determine where the initial plane is.

I also have a GTC-300 on my Z06. Read this and all your questions will be answered;

http://aprperformance.com/racing-pro...ustable-wings/

Generally, somewhere between level and ten degrees is where you should be, although it all depends on your car set up

You should be measuring on a flat placed in the middle of the wing (last sentence of definitions on GTC-300 page).
